Shorts are vertical videos that are designed to be viewed on a mobile device. They are up to 60 seconds long and can be created using a smartphone or a camera. Shorts can include a variety of content, such as music, comedy, and educational videos. They are designed to be easy to create and share, making them a popular choice for content creators.

Apart from age and upload frequency, several other factors can affect Shorts ranking on YouTube. These include engagement, audience retention, and video quality. Shorts that receive a high level of engagement, such as likes, comments, and shares, are more likely to rank well. Audience retention, which refers to the amount of time viewers spend watching the Shorts, is also vital. Shorts that have a high audience retention rate are more likely to rank higher. Additionally, Shorts that are of high quality, both in terms of content and production, are more likely to rank higher.
There are several strategies content creators can use to improve the ranking of their Shorts on YouTube. These include creating high-quality content, optimizing titles and descriptions, using relevant hashtags, and engaging with the audience. Additionally, content creators can promote their Shorts on social media platforms such as Instagram, Twitter, and TikTok to increase engagement and visibility.
